A dental crown is a cap that covers a damaged, cracked, or root canal-treated tooth. It restores both the appearance and function of the natural tooth.
A dental bridge is used to replace one or more missing teeth. It’s made up of artificial teeth (pontics) supported by crowns placed on adjacent teeth or implants.

Yes. If your crown or bridge becomes loose, cracks, or the underlying tooth becomes decayed, it can usually be replaced. Prompt treatment ensures you maintain function and appearance without complications.
